How much do part time appointment scheduler j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time appointment scheduler in the United States is $18.52,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.87 and $20.19 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Part Time Appointment Scheduler vs Part Time Receptionist?

AspectPart Time Appointment SchedulerPart Time Receptionist
Primary RoleScheduling appointments, managing calendarsGreeting visitors, answering calls, general front desk duties
Required SkillsScheduling software, organizationCommunication, customer service
Work EnvironmentMedical offices, clinics, salonsMedical offices, hotels, corporate reception areas
CertificationsNone typically required, some familiarity with scheduling softwareNone typically required, customer service skills preferred

While both roles involve front-office tasks, the Part Time Appointment Scheduler primarily focuses on managing appointment schedules and calendar coordination, whereas the Part Time Receptionist handles greeting visitors and general front desk responsibilities. The roles often overlap in healthcare settings but differ in core duties and skill emphasis.

Job description

About Us

Cooper University Health Care is an integrated healthcare delivery system serving residents and visitors throughout Cape May County. The system includes Cooper University Hospital Cape Regional; three urgent care facilities; nearly 30 primary care and specialty care offices in multiple locations throughout Cape May County; The Cancer Center at Cooper University Hospital Cape Regional; the Claire C. Brodesser Surgery Center; AMI at Cooper, Miracles Fitness and numerous freestanding outpatient facilities providing wound care, lab, and physical therapy services. We have a commitment to our employees by providing competitive rates and compensation programs.  Cooper offers full and part time employees a comprehensive employee benefits program, including health, dental, vision, life, disability, retirement, on-site Early Education Center (employee discount), attractive working conditions, and the chance to build and explore a career opportunity by offering professional development.

Short Description
  • Promptly and professionally answers telephone calls.  Provides complete explanation of testing instructions and preparations.
  • Schedules services, ensuring all aspects of appointments are appropriate and accurate, including patient demographics and appointment details.

  • Obtains and records patient insurance, prescription, referral and other financial and clinical documents.  Explains financial requirements to the patients or responsible parties.  Verifies insurance eligibility and ensures that insurance requirements are met prior to delivery of service.

  • Accurately processes all requests and documents appropriate information in CAST tracking tool based on established office protocol.

Experience Required
  • Experience in Diagnostic Imaging Scheduling.
  • Previous data entry or typing experience and knowledge of basic office equipment required.  Computer experience required.
Education Requirements

High School Diploma or equivalent.
